# Ignition: a beautiful error page for Laravel apps

[Ignition](https://flareapp.io/docs/ignition-for-laravel/introduction) is a beautiful and customizable error page for Laravel applications. It is the default error page for new Laravel applications. It also allows to publicly share your errors on [Flare](https://flareapp.io). If configured with a valid Flare API key, your errors in production applications will be tracked, and you'll get notified when they happen.

`spatie/laravel-ignition` works for Laravel 8 and 9 applications running on PHP 8.0 and above. Looking for Ignition for Laravel 5.x, 6.x or 7.x or old PHP versions? `facade/ignition` is still compatible.
